If the word can be hyphenated you will see … dictionary concatenationWeb12 jun. 2024 · Words with pre-fixes often need a hyphen to make them clearer because of the spelling. There is a shop in the UK called ‘The Co-op’(short form of ‘co-operative’). Without the hyphen, it would be ‘The Coop’(where chickens sleep).
